Common Reddit Marketing Mistakes
Avoid these pitfalls that get consultants banned or ignored on Reddit
Being too salesy
Consultants often jump to "let me help you" in ways that feel pushy. Reddit users reject this.
Help first, pitch never. Let clients come to you after seeing your expertise.
Giving away everything
Some consultants fear giving too much value for free. But surface answers do not convert.
Give genuinely helpful answers. Real expertise is not diminished by sharing knowledge.
Generic advice
Consulting is about specific situations. Generic advice is not impressive.
Ask clarifying questions. Provide context-specific guidance. Demonstrate how you think.
No follow-through
Dropping one great answer then disappearing wastes the relationship.
Stay engaged. Follow up on threads. Build ongoing relationships in communities.
